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#816A02 belongs to the Yellow Color Family, featuring Full Saturation and Neutral br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(129, 106, 2) — 50.6% red, 41.6% green, 0.8%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 0 / 9 / 50 / 49.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#816A02 is a maximally vivid golden yellow that sits comfortably between light and dark. In practice it works well for bold branding moments and attention-grabbing details.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Ugly Brown (#7D7103). Nearby in the Register you will also find Muddy Brown (#886806) and Poop (#7F5E00).

In RGB terms — rgb(129, 106, 2) — the red channel does the heavy lifting here. If you plan to put text on a #816A02 background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 5.3:1 (passing WCAG AA), while black manages only 4.0:1. #816A02 has no official name yet. #816A02 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
